Norwegian Jade entered service in 2006 as part of Norwegian Cruise Line’s Jewel class and was built by Meyer Werft in Germany. Jade has sailed across diverse regions, including Asia, the Caribbean, and South America, and remains active in the fleet, registered in Nassau, Bahamas. The ship underwent a refurbishment in 2022 to modernize its staterooms, public areas, and onboard amenities.

Name
Norwegian Jade
Operator
Norwegian Cruise Line
Port of registry
Nassau, Bahamas
Laid down
2005
Launched
2006
Completed
November 2006
Maiden voyage
December 2006
In service
2006 – Present
Identification
IMO 9304057
Status
Active
Tonnage
93,558 GT
Length
294 m (964 ft)
Beam
32 m (105 ft)
Draught
8.2 m (approx.)
Decks
15 decks (12 passenger accessible)
